A Manchester-based investment agency is seeking a Business Development Executive to support the team in attracting companies to Greater Manchester. The ideal candidate should have a degree, experience in sales or lead generation, and strong communication skills.
Responsibilities include:
- Managing investor inquiries
- Supporting investment activities
- Conducting research
This role offers a chance to contribute to Greater Manchester’s economic development and work with diverse stakeholders.

How to prepare for a job interview at The Growth Company
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you research the investment agency and Greater Manchester's economic landscape. Understand their goals and how your role as a Business Development Executive can help attract companies to the area. This will show your genuine interest and commitment.
✨Showcase Your Sales Skills
Prepare examples from your past experiences in sales or lead generation. Be ready to discuss specific strategies you've used to attract clients or manage inquiries. This will demonstrate your capability to handle the responsibilities of the role effectively.
✨Communicate Clearly
Strong communication skills are key for this position.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Consider doing mock interviews with friends or family to refine your delivery and ensure you can engage with diverse stakeholders effortlessly.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the agency's current projects, challenges, and future plans.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company aligns with your career aspirations. It’s a great way to leave a lasting impression!
